Transaction 40a8118b70a024d89f35d56ea9836e840a8326475f3c3b62f689967943173480

1 Input
2 Outputs
  • 40a8118b70a024d89f35d56ea9836e840a8326475f3c3b62f689967943173480:0
  • value  3437500
    address  2NBMEXSzh5eVcpfGeUD7rQT3UqeVxSkr6x1
  • 40a8118b70a024d89f35d56ea9836e840a8326475f3c3b62f689967943173480:1
  • value  9362193554
    address  2NCUHMzHwwCNNixYkXgwcTre3hK4ShX5TwP